Site-specific oxygen-18 labelling of silica-supported vanadium(V) complexes: Implications for oxidation catalysis

The incorporation of 18 O isotope labels into specific positions of oxide-supported vanadium complexes has been achieved by grafting VOCl 3 onto silica. The gas phase reaction of VOCl 3 with the hydroxyl groups of the silica surface yields exclusively SiOV(O)Cl 2 . When the hydroxyl groups are first exchanged with H 2 , 18 O, the subsequent reaction with V 16 OCl 3 gives uniquely Si 18 OV 16 OCl 2 . Reaction of V 18 OCl 3 with unlabelled silica gives only Si 16 OV 18 OCl 2 . Exchange of the chloride ligands with alcohols gives SiOV(O)Cl(OR) and SiOV(O)(OR) 2 sequentially, without displacing or diluting the isotope labels. The thermal and photochemical reactions of SiOV(O)Cl 2 with the substrates ArNCO and CO, respectively, proceed by oxygen transfer uniquely from the terminal oxo position, as shown by the isotope distribution of the CO 2 product formed in each reaction. When the reactions are run under catalytic conditions, below 70°C, no incorporation of the lattice oxygen of silica into CO 2 was observed.
